Improving oneself is an ongoing journey that encompasses various aspects of life, including physical health, mental well-being, personal development, and social relationships. In this comprehensive article, we will explore key areas of self-improvement, providing practical tips and insights to help you embark on a fulfilling path of personal growth. 1. Mindset Mastery: Developing a positive mindset is foundational to self-improvement. Cultivate a growth mindset, believing that your abilities and intelligence can be developed through dedication and hard work. Challenge negative thoughts, embrace failures as opportunities to learn, and foster resilience in the face of challenges. 2. Goal Setting and Planning: Set clear, achievable goals for yourself. Break them down into smaller, manageable tasks and create a timeline. Regularly review and adjust your goals as needed. This structured approach will help you stay focused, motivated, and organized in your pursuit of self-improvement. 3. Time Management: Efficiently managing your time is crucial for personal growth. Identify your priorities, eliminate time-wasting activities, and create a daily schedule that allows for both productivity and relaxation. Utilize techniques such as the Pomodoro Technique to enhance focus and productivity. 4. Continuous Learning: Commit to lifelong learning. Whether it's formal education, online courses, or self-directed reading, expanding your knowledge and skills opens doors to new opportunities. Stay curious and embrace challenges that encourage intellectual growth. 5. Physical Well-being: Take care of your body through regular exercise, a balanced diet, and sufficient sleep. Physical health significantly impacts mental well-being and overall productivity. Incorporate activities you enjoy into your fitness routine to make it sustainable. 6. Mindfulness and Stress Management: Practice mindfulness to stay present and reduce stress. Techniques such as meditation, deep breathing, and yoga can enhance your ability to manage challenges calmly. Regular self-reflection can also provide insights into your thoughts and emotions. 7. Effective Communication: Develop strong communication skills to enhance your personal and professional relationships. Active listening, clarity in expression, and empathy are key components of effective communication. Seek feedback to continually refine and improve your communication style. 8. Building Resilience: Embrace setbacks and challenges as opportunities for growth. Resilience is the ability to bounce back from adversity. Cultivate this trait by learning from failures, maintaining a positive outlook, and developing coping mechanisms. 9. Financial Literacy: Take control of your finances by budgeting, saving, and investing wisely. Financial stability provides a sense of security and freedom. Educate yourself on money management and make informed decisions about your financial future. 10.
